Song Summary
“Hithata Hithena De” is a soulful track by Dushan Jayathilaka that explores the simple yet profound desire for a genuine romantic connection. The song reflects on the compromises one is willing to make in a relationship—such as enduring busy schedules or the lack of grand gestures—as long as the core foundation of love is strong. It captures a universal human longing for a partner who values life and love above all else, providing a sense of security against loneliness.
Song Meaning
The song dives into the realism of modern relationships, moving away from idealized fairy tales. The narrator expresses that they don’t need “love poems,” “grand sacrifices,” or constant attention to be happy. Instead, they emphasize that a deep, soul-level love (“Pana ta wada” – more than life) is the only requirement to feel whole. The lyrics suggest that while small hurts and external pressures (like friends or time constraints) are part of life, they become insignificant when true affection exists. It is a song about prioritizing emotional depth over performative romance.
